Once you've made the desired changes to the configuration, you need to apply those changes in order to take effect, and start capturing, and organizing information according to your requirements. Until that changes are not applied, the system will continue to operate according to the actual configuration.
Before applying the configuration, the system will inform you if there is any blocking issue that need to be solve prior to initialize. You will also see non-blocking validations that could help you improve the configuration.
Having solved blockers issues, the "apply changes" button will be enabled.
What are blocking and nonblocking validations?
A set of rules that establish minimum requirements (blocking) for each step of the configuration (Capture, Information Structure) and informative validations that inform you about “missing configurations” (non-blocking).

Changes overview
Each change made in capture sources, search terms or information structure, will be reflected here. You can quickly review the changes made, before applying them.
